Your connection string needs to be a low privileged account. Hopefully your
developers were able to design it that way. How are they encrypted? Using
DPAPI? It will still be much harder for an attacker to compromise the
database if it's on a separate server. You've created a barrier by
encrypting the connection string, so they won't be able to connect to SQL
without it right? Or are you also using trusted connections?
I can't comment on 1 high power vs 2 low power, because I've no idea of the
performance requirements and load the servers expect. You know, if there's a
lot of database activity, it's best to separate the database files and
transaction logs to separate disks and controllers ideally.
SQL auth is never recommended, Windows auth always is. I would say
separate into two boxes if you can, harden both servers. Especially lock
down SQL and the application - use low privileged accounts, run all requests
through Stored procedures or parameterized queries. Apply strict
permissions to the database and tables.
Your correct, separating into two servers won't buy you much unless you
properly design the application, host configurations, and account access
permissions.
Have a pen-test run on your web-app, that's usually where most holes into
the network are found.

>> This has always been a recommendation from the security community. the
>> issue is that separating roles is a security practice - you DON'T want to
>> host your database on the same server that hosts your Web server. Surely
>> however, you would apply proper Firewall rules that only allow inbound
>> TCP
>> 80 and 443, and not 1433. The reasons for separation are numerous.
>> For
>> example, a vulnerability in IIS would lead to a direct compromise of the
>> data.
>>
>> This issue is largely dependent on the application's design. Are you
>> allowing Anonymous access? Then your chances of getting compromised are
>> that much greater.
>>
>> Honestly, this recommendation was originally conceived from the notion of
>> separating application components - one that serves web pages and one
>> that
>> holds data. But it was also conceived during the early days of IIS 4/5
>> when
>> vulnerabilities were very severe and seeemed to come out every week.
>> IIS6
>> is much stronger.
>>
>> You could get away with it on one server, but you need to lock down IIS,
>> SQL
>> permissions, and the application's functionality as much as possible.
>> If you can afford two boxes and separate them by a firewall - DO IT.
>> But remember, if your making your connection from IIS to SQL as a full
>> sysadmin or dbo level, then once your IIS box gets compromised, the
>> hacker
>> will likely have access to the database with that level of permission.
>> SO,
>> USE a LOW PRIVILEGED account for data access.
>>
>> The majority of attacks today are exploiting poorly written
>> web-applications, not the underlying infrastructure so much.
